Beyonce’s performance at Coachella on Saturday, April 14, 2018, is the talk of the town on the Internet. For Nigerians, is even more special because King Bey paid tribute to the legendary Fela Anikulapo Kuti. During her enchanting set, Beyonce’s band performed a rendition of the Afrobeat legend’s classic 1976 track, “Zombie”. It can best be described as moving. Beyoncé’s performance on the second night of Coachella can be described as highly anticipated after she cancelled her headlining performance for 2017’s edition due to her pregnancy. In celebration of his birthday today, singer Kcee has released the video for his new single ‘Bullion Van’. Barely 24 hours after the singer unveiled his underwear line called ‘La Cueca’ with photos of himself as model, the singer has dropped his first single of the year. The single which is titled ‘Bullion Van’ is produced by award winning beat-maker Blaq Jerzee with the video for the song directed by Moses Inwang for Sneeze Films. The accolades are still rolling in for Mohamed Salah who can now add the Champions League Goal of the Week (for the quarterfinals) award to his already swollen list of achievements this season. The in-form Liverpool winger took the vote for his delightful dink against Manchester City in the last eight, though many neutral fans are questioning whether or not the award deserved to go to Cristiano Ronaldo for his all-the-more spectacular overhead effort against Juventus.
